1918 Alabama gubernatorial election

The 1918 Alabama gubernatorial election took place on November 2, 1918, to elect the Governor of Alabama. Democratic incumbent Charles Henderson was term-limited, and could not seek a second consecutive term.

Results

Alabama gubernatorial election, 1918[1]
Party Candidate Votes %
Democratic Thomas Kilby 54,716 80.21
Independent Dallas B. Smith 13,497 19.79
Total votes 68,213 100.00
Democratic hold
